
在Excel中复制多行数据可以通过以下几种方法:使用快捷键、右键菜单、使用“填充柄”、VBA宏等。快捷键、右键菜单是最常见的方式。下面将详细介绍这些方法。
一、快捷键复制
快捷键是最快速、最有效的复制方式之一。对于习惯于键盘操作的用户,这种方式非常高效。
1、使用Ctrl+C和Ctrl+V
- 选中要复制的多行数据:点击并拖动鼠标或使用Shift键和方向键进行选择。
- 按下Ctrl+C:这会将选中的数据复制到剪贴板。
- 选中目标位置:点击目标单元格或区域。
- 按下Ctrl+V:将剪贴板上的数据粘贴到目标位置。
2、使用Ctrl+Shift+箭头键
- 选中起始单元格:点击需要复制的第一行第一个单元格。
- 按下Ctrl+Shift+下箭头键:快速选择到数据末尾。
- 按下Ctrl+C:将选中的数据复制到剪贴板。
- 选中目标位置:点击目标单元格。
- 按下Ctrl+V:粘贴数据。
二、右键菜单复制
右键菜单是用户界面友好的复制方式,适合不熟悉快捷键的用户。
1、通过右键菜单复制
- 选中要复制的多行数据:点击并拖动鼠标或使用Shift键和方向键进行选择。
- 右键点击选中的区域:弹出右键菜单。
- 选择“复制”:将数据复制到剪贴板。
- 右键点击目标位置:弹出右键菜单。
- 选择“粘贴”:将数据粘贴到目标位置。
2、使用右键菜单中的“复制到”
- 选中要复制的多行数据:点击并拖动鼠标或使用Shift键和方向键进行选择。
- 右键点击选中的区域:弹出右键菜单。
- 选择“复制到”:弹出复制到对话框。
- 输入目标位置:例如A1或C5。
- 点击“确定”:数据将被复制到指定位置。
三、使用“填充柄”复制
“填充柄”是一种快捷的复制方式,特别适用于连续数据。
1、使用“填充柄”复制
- 选中要复制的多行数据:点击并拖动鼠标或使用Shift键和方向键进行选择。
- 将鼠标放在选中区域的右下角:光标变成一个小十字形。
- 按住左键拖动:向下或向侧拖动光标。
- 松开左键:数据将被复制到拖动的区域。
四、使用VBA宏复制
对于复杂的复制任务,VBA宏可以自动化操作,提高效率。
1、录制VBA宏
- 打开Excel:并选择“开发工具”选项卡。
- 点击“录制宏”:输入宏的名称。
- 执行复制操作:例如使用快捷键或右键菜单。
- 停止录制宏:点击“停止录制”。
2、运行VBA宏
- 打开宏对话框:按下Alt+F8。
- 选择刚才录制的宏:并点击“运行”。
- 宏将自动执行复制操作:完成多行数据的复制。
五、使用Excel内置功能复制
Excel有许多内置功能可以帮助用户复制数据,例如“查找和选择”、“筛选”等。
1、使用“查找和选择”复制
- 选中要复制的多行数据:点击并拖动鼠标或使用Shift键和方向键进行选择。
- 点击“开始”选项卡:选择“查找和选择”。
- 选择“选择性粘贴”:弹出选择性粘贴对话框。
- 选择需要的选项:例如仅粘贴值或格式。
2、使用筛选功能复制
- 应用筛选条件:点击“数据”选项卡,选择“筛选”。
- 选择需要的行:应用筛选条件后,选中要复制的行。
- 按下Ctrl+C:将选中的数据复制到剪贴板。
- 选中目标位置:点击目标单元格。
- 按下Ctrl+V:粘贴数据。
六、使用Excel公式复制
Excel公式也可以用于复制数据,特别适用于动态数据。
1、使用公式复制
- 在目标单元格中输入公式:例如=A1。
- 按下Enter键:公式将引用指定单元格的数据。
- 拖动填充柄:向下或向侧拖动公式。
2、使用数组公式复制
- 选中目标区域:例如A1:A10。
- 输入数组公式:例如={A1:A10}。
- 按下Ctrl+Shift+Enter:数组公式将应用到整个区域。
七、使用Excel外部工具复制
有许多外部工具可以与Excel集成,帮助用户完成复杂的复制任务。
1、使用Excel插件
- 安装插件:例如Kutools for Excel。
- 选择复制功能:插件通常提供增强的复制功能。
- 执行复制操作:按照插件的指引完成复制。
2、使用第三方软件
- 安装第三方软件:例如Excel to PDF。
- 导入Excel文件:选择需要复制的数据。
- 执行复制操作:按照软件的指引完成复制。
总结,在Excel中复制多行数据的方法多种多样,用户可以根据自己的需求选择最适合的方式。快捷键、右键菜单、使用“填充柄”是最常见的方法,而对于复杂任务,可以考虑使用VBA宏、Excel内置功能、公式、外部工具等方式。这些方法不仅可以提高工作效率,还能确保数据的准确性和一致性。
相关问答FAQs:
1. 如何在Excel中一次性复制多行数据?
- 在Excel表格中,选择要复制的第一行数据,并按住Shift键,同时点击表格中的最后一行数据,这样就可以选择多行数据。
- 在选中的多行数据上点击鼠标右键,然后选择“复制”选项。
- 在目标位置上点击鼠标右键,然后选择“粘贴”选项,选中的多行数据就会被复制到目标位置。
2. 如何在Excel中复制非连续的多行数据?
- 在Excel表格中,按住Ctrl键,同时点击表格中需要复制的每一行数据,这样就可以选择非连续的多行数据。
- 在选中的多行数据上点击鼠标右键,然后选择“复制”选项。
- 在目标位置上点击鼠标右键,然后选择“粘贴”选项,选中的多行数据就会被复制到目标位置。
3. 如何在Excel中复制多行数据并保留原有格式?
- 在Excel表格中,选择要复制的多行数据。
- 在选中的多行数据上点击鼠标右键,然后选择“复制”选项。
- 在目标位置上点击鼠标右键,然后选择“粘贴特殊”选项。
- 在“粘贴特殊”对话框中,选择“值”和“格式”选项,然后点击“确定”按钮,选中的多行数据就会被复制到目标位置,并保留原有的格式。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4330431